Oklahoma’s JJ Cale is the very definition of influential, having written standards like “Cocaine”, “After Midnight” and “Call Me The Breeze” while laying down the groundwork for hundreds of roots-rock followers.Now at age 65, JJ’s still got some tips for the youngsters.
